MEDIA ADVISORY

The Waseda University Institute of e-Government announces the release of its annual research on the development of e-Government worldwide, the Waseda University International e-Government Ranking.

This year marks the 5th anniversary of the Waseda University international e-Government Rankings. Aside from the annual rankings, the research group also looked back on the past 5 years and studied the evolution of e-Government since the research initially conducted. This year, to enhance the research, changes were made on the ranking process to be able to reflect the current times and best capture on the status of e-Government around the world. This study also provides an insight into ongoing trends and developing trends in e-Government. This year's study can be best described by the theme "Review and Foresight".

Using a comprehensive set of parameters in order to benchmark the development of e-Government in selected countries in the world, the outcome of this research compares the real situation of e-Government in a given country with an "ideal" e-Government situation.

The Waseda University International e-Government Ranking continues to be the main e-Government benchmarking initiative in the Asian Region. The results will be continuously cited by both governmental agencies and mass media as well as research institutions in the world.

The final results of this research are attached with the hope that they will give contribution to the e-government development.
